Why Energy Storage is Essential for a Green Transition

Energy storage plays a crucial role in adding high levels of renewable energy to the grid and reducing the demand for electricity from inefficient, polluting power plants.

How does energy storage help reduce the need for new power plants

By alleviating pressure on the grid, energy storage systems delay the need for new substations or power lines, which are often required to support increased electricity demand.
